#c53d9f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c53d9f is composed of 77.3% red, 23.9%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69% magenta, 19.3%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 316.8 degrees, a saturation of 54% and a lightness of 50.6%. #c53d9f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7aff with #8b003f.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#c53d9f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#fbf2f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c53d9f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818181 is the less saturated color, while #f50db4 is the most saturated one.
